<p>Just yesterday the Glyfyx (aka <a href="http://psyops.com" target="_blank">PSY/OPS</a>) crew visited California College of the Arts&#8217; type design exhibition <a href="http://www.cca.edu/calendar/2013/types-characters-history-cca-type-design" target="_blank">Types and Characters</a>. The exhibit was beautifully curated by three students of <a href="http://www.stripesf.com" target="_blank">Jon Sueda</a>&#8216;s Advanced Design Exhibition class. Impressive work.</p>
<p>The exhibit featured three of CCA&#8217;s amazing type anchors (who were also interviewed in the latest issue of <a href="http://issuu.com/californiacollegeofthearts/docs/glance-issuu_version" target="_blank">Glance magazine</a>) <a href="http://www.fontboy.com" target="_blank">Bob Afouldish</a>, <a href="http://jamestedmondson.com" target="_blank">James T. Edmondson</a>, and our very own <a href="http://psyops.com" target="_blank">Rod Cavazos</a>. They answered tough lettering and typography questions posed by a large crowd of what can only be called &#8220;type nerds.&#8221;</p>

<p>The exhibit also showcased seven years of student work done in Rod&#8217;s type design course in which students start the class sketching the letters on napkins, and leave with their very own workable typeface.</p>

		</p><p>We are happy to announce that a series of vibrant typographic greeting cards and postcards now grace <a title="SHOP" href="http://www.glyfyx.com/shop/">our virtual shelves</a>. Each art card features a vibrant illustration inspired by letters and letter shapes. The cards feature posters originally created for our sister site <a href="http://psyops.com" target="_blank">PSY/OPS Type Foundry</a> (which kinda explains our love for everything alphabet). Each poster is inspired by and makes use of a single typeface found in the PSY/OPS library. These cards are far from your average typography card; they are wacky, swirly, abstract art cards, but if you look closely you&#8217;ll see chunks of letters and punctuation.</p>

<p>At Glyfyx we play around with lots of game ideas, and nothing beats playing off-screen with dice and game pieces. We made and collected these wooden pieces, dice, and cards ourselves to test out ideas and have fun.</p>
<p><img class="alignnone  wp-image-3229" alt="Glyfyx Game Pieces" src="http://www.glyfyx.com/wp-content/uploads/2013/03/photo-14.jpg" width="500" /></p>
<p>Looking around the internet we found some other examples of hand-made or vintage game pieces. They have such a warm feeling that is difficult to achieve with the plastic game pieces of today.</p>
